According to second postulate of Bohr model, the angular momentum (Ln)\left( L_{n} \right) of nth possible orbit of hydrogen atom is given by

A

h2πn\frac{h}{2\pi n}

B

nh2π\frac{nh}{2\pi}

C

2πnh\frac{2\pi n}{h}

D

2πnh\frac{2\pi}{nh}

Answer

nh2π\frac{nh}{2\pi}

Explanation

Solution

Angular momentum

Ln=mvnrn=nh2π=nhL_{n} = mv_{n}r_{n} = \frac{nh}{2\pi} = nh

Where h = planks constant

rn=r_{n} = Radius of nth orbit

vnv_{n}= Velocity of electron in nth orbit
